Boats and Streams

1. A boat can travel 144 km upstream in 12 hrs and the same distance downstream in 6 hrs. In how many hours a boat can travel 360 km in both upstream and downstream? (In hrs) 

A) 56    B) 39  C) 28    D) 45    E) 50

 Sol: Speed of the boat = x 

        speed of the stream = y 

        upstream speed = x − y 

       downstream speed = x + y

Ans: D

10. A boat covers a distance of 60 km in 3 hrs in downstream. If speed of stream is 5 kmph, then find time taken by boat to cover 45 km in upstream and 60 km in downstream?

 A) 5.5 h    B) 7.5 h    C) 9 h    D) 11.5 h   E) 12 h 

x + y = 20 kmph 

stream speed (y) = 5 kmph 

x + 5 = 20

 x = 15 kmph (boat speed)

Ans: B
